pub struct AudioEncoderBuilder { /* private fields */ }Expand description
Builder for constructing an AudioEncoder.
Created by calling AudioEncoder::create(). Call build()
to open the output file and prepare for encoding.
§Examples
use ff_encode::{AudioEncoder, AudioCodec};
let mut encoder = AudioEncoder::create("output.m4a")
.audio(48000, 2)
.audio_codec(AudioCodec::Aac)
.build()?;Implementations§

Sourcepub fn codec_opt(self, key: impl Into<String>, value: impl Into<String>) -> Self
pub fn codec_opt(self, key: impl Into<String>, value: impl Into<String>) -> Self
Set a codec-private option by name, for the long tail that has no typed builder (libopus and AAC tuning knobs, and so on).
Repeatable, and applied in call order via av_opt_set on the codec’s
priv_data before avcodec_open2, after
codec_options() — so a key named here overrides
the same key set through the typed API.
§Escape-hatch semantics
Prefer codec_options(): it is validated at
compile time and portable across encoders. Nothing here is checked until
FFmpeg sees it, and keys are codec-specific.
Unlike the typed options, which log and continue when an encoder does not
support them, an option rejected here fails build() with
crate::EncodeError::InvalidConfig — the key was named explicitly, so
dropping it silently would defeat the purpose.
Sourcepub fn codec_options(self, opts: AudioCodecOptions) -> Self
pub fn codec_options(self, opts: AudioCodecOptions) -> Self
Set per-codec encoding options.
The variant must match the codec set via audio_codec().
A mismatch is silently ignored.
Sourcepub fn build(self) -> Result<AudioEncoder, EncodeError>
pub fn build(self) -> Result<AudioEncoder, EncodeError>
Validate builder state and open the output file.
§Errors
Returns EncodeError if configuration is invalid, the output path
cannot be created, or no suitable encoder is found.
